本文以linux平台下CMakeLists.txt文件书写方法总结。
一 开头通用模块
1.1 cmake版本要求
cmake_minimum_required( VERSION 2.8 )
#工程文件名loop_closure,可任取
project( loop_closure )
1.2 编译模式
IF(NOT CMAKE_BUILD_TYPE) SET(CMAKE_BUILD_TYPE Release) ENDIF()
MESSAGE("Build type: " ${CMAKE_BUILD_TYPE})
当然如果此处在前面加上语句:
set(CMAKE_BUILD_TYPE debug)
即表示设置为debug模式编译。
1.3 检查C++版本
检查C++的版本
# Check C++11 or C++0x support include(CheckCXXCompilerFlag) CHECK_CXX_COMPILER_FLAG("-std=c++11" COMPILER_SUPPORTS_CXX11) CHECK_CXX_COMPILER_FLAG("-std=c++0x" COMPILER_SUPPORTS_CXX0X) if(COMPILER_SUPPORTS_CXX11) set(CMAKE_CXX_FLAGS "${CMAKE_CXX_FLAGS} -std=c++11") add_definitions(-DCOMPILEDWITHC11) message(STATUS "Using flag -std=c++11.") elseif(COMPILER_SUPPORTS_CXX0X) set(CMAKE_CXX_FLAGS "${CMAKE_CXX_FLAGS} -std=c++0x") add_definitions(-DCOMPILEDWITHC0X) message(STATUS "Using flag -std=c++0x.") else() message(FATAL_ERROR "The compiler ${CMAKE_CXX_COMPILER} has no C++11 support. Please use a different C++ compiler.") endif()
二 项目文件配置模块
接下来,便开始配置各个库模块。
2.1 如果仅包含OpenCV库时
set(OpenCV_DIR "/usr/local/include/opencv3.2.0/share/OpenCV") find_package(OpenCV REQUIRED)
include_directories( ${OpenCV_INCLUDE_DIRS} )
#生成可执行文件
add_executable(${PROJECT_NAME} src/loop_closure.cpp )
target_link_libraries(${PROJECT_NAME} ${OpenCV_LIBS})
备注:这里的OpenCV包含目录为含有OpenCVConfig.cmake的路径。

2.2 如果包含第三方库,该库为源码形式(.h和.cpp),非动态链接库

此处以在工程中添加词袋库DBoW2为例,这里的DBoW2是以源码形式包含,也即未编译成.so文件。

2.2.1 包含第三库的头文件
#设置.h文件对应的路径
set( DBoW2_INCLUDE_DIRS ${PROJECT_SOURCE_DIR}/ThirdParty/DBow-master/include/)
#包含.h文件路径
include_directories( ${OpenCV_INCLUDE_DIRS} ${DBoW2_INCLUDE_DIRS} ${DBoW2_INCLUDE_DIRS}/DBoW2/)
注:上述为啥要用两条路径${DBoW2_INCLUDE_DIRS}和${DBoW2_INCLUDE_DIRS}/DBoW2/?


为了防止在include层找不到,继续往下一层路径include/DBoW2/路径下查找,这是为了防止某些文件的包含路径不一致导致头文件查找错误。
2.2.2 包含第三方库的cpp文件


set(DBoW2_SRCS "${PROJECT_SOURCE_DIR}/ThirdParty/DBow-master/src") #生成可执行文件 add_executable(${PROJECT_NAME} src/loop_closure.cpp src/run_main.cpp ${DBoW2_SRCS}/BowVector.cpp ${DBoW2_SRCS}/FBrief.cpp ${DBoW2_SRCS}/FeatureVector.cpp ${DBoW2_SRCS}/FORB.cpp ${DBoW2_SRCS}/FSurf64.cpp ${DBoW2_SRCS}/QueryResults.cpp ${DBoW2_SRCS}/ScoringObject.cpp)
其中,src/loop_closure.cpp src/run_main.cpp 为本工程中我自己实现的,而对于其他的cpp文件,则直接添加路径即可。
另一种方式,添加cpp文件路径更为简洁方便。
file(GLOB DBoW2_SRCS ${PROJECT_SOURCE_DIR}/ThirdParty/DBow-master/src/*.cpp) add_executable(${PROJECT_NAME} src/loop_closure.cpp src/run_main.cpp ${DBoW2_SRCS})
2.3 如果包含第三方库,为库形式(此处以静态库为例(.a后缀))
在上述工程下,同时还包含有DBoW3库,此库已经按默认路径编译安装到计算机内存中。我们可以按如下方式添加DBoW3库。
1)包含头文件
set( DBoW3_INCLUDE_DIRS "/usr/local/include")
2)添加库
set( DBoW3_LIBS "/usr/local/lib/libDBoW3.a")
target_link_libraries(${PROJECT_NAME} ${OpenCV_LIBS} ${DBoW3_LIBS} )
通过上述方式,即可调用。
三 一个简单的CMakeLists.txt文件demo
该demo中相较于上述总结添加的库,还额外包含了DLib库。
cmake_minimum_required( VERSION 2.8 ) project( loop_closure ) #set(CMAKE_BUILD_TYPE Debug) IF(NOT CMAKE_BUILD_TYPE) SET(CMAKE_BUILD_TYPE Release) ENDIF() MESSAGE("Build type: " ${CMAKE_BUILD_TYPE}) # Check C++11 or C++0x support include(CheckCXXCompilerFlag) CHECK_CXX_COMPILER_FLAG("-std=c++11" COMPILER_SUPPORTS_CXX11) CHECK_CXX_COMPILER_FLAG("-std=c++0x" COMPILER_SUPPORTS_CXX0X) if(COMPILER_SUPPORTS_CXX11) set(CMAKE_CXX_FLAGS "${CMAKE_CXX_FLAGS} -std=c++11") add_definitions(-DCOMPILEDWITHC11) message(STATUS "Using flag -std=c++11.") elseif(COMPILER_SUPPORTS_CXX0X) set(CMAKE_CXX_FLAGS "${CMAKE_CXX_FLAGS} -std=c++0x") add_definitions(-DCOMPILEDWITHC0X) message(STATUS "Using flag -std=c++0x.") else() message(FATAL_ERROR "The compiler ${CMAKE_CXX_COMPILER} has no C++11 support. Please use a different C++ compiler.") endif() #opencv #set(OpenCV_DIR "/usr/local/include/opencv3.2.0/share/OpenCV") set(OpenCV_DIR "/opt/ros/kinetic/share/OpenCV-3.3.1-dev") find_package(OpenCV REQUIRED) set( DBoW3_INCLUDE_DIRS "/usr/local/include") set( DBoW2_INCLUDE_DIRS ${PROJECT_SOURCE_DIR}/ThirdParty/DBow-master/include/) message(${DBoW2_INCLUDE_DIRS}) #important #file(GLOB DBoW2_SRCS ${PROJECT_SOURCE_DIR}/ThirdParty/DBow-master/src/*.cpp) #message(${DBoW2_SRCS}) set(DBoW2_SRCS "${PROJECT_SOURCE_DIR}/ThirdParty/DBow-master/src") message(${DBoW2_SRCS}) find_package(DLib QUIET PATHS ${DEPENDENCY_INSTALL_DIR}) if(${DLib_FOUND}) message("DLib library found, using it from the system") include_directories(${DLib_INCLUDE_DIRS}) add_custom_target(Dependencies) else(${DLib_FOUND}) message("DLib library not found in the system, it will be downloaded on build") option(DOWNLOAD_DLib_dependency "Download DLib dependency" ON) if(${DOWNLOAD_DLib_dependency}) ExternalProject_Add(DLib PREFIX ${DEPENDENCY_DIR} GIT_REPOSITORY http://github.com/dorian3d/DLib GIT_TAG master INSTALL_DIR ${DEPENDENCY_INSTALL_DIR} CMAKE_ARGS -DCMAKE_INSTALL_PREFIX=<INSTALL_DIR>) add_custom_target(Dependencies ${CMAKE_COMMAND} ${CMAKE_SOURCE_DIR} DEPENDS DLib) else() message(SEND_ERROR "Please, activate DOWNLOAD_DLib_dependency option or download manually") endif(${DOWNLOAD_DLib_dependency}) endif(${DLib_FOUND}) include_directories( ${OpenCV_INCLUDE_DIRS} ${DBoW3_INCLUDE_DIRS} ${DBoW2_INCLUDE_DIRS} ${DBoW2_INCLUDE_DIRS}/DBoW2/) message("DBoW3_INCLUDE_DIRS ${DBoW3_INCLUDE_DIRS}") message("DBoW2_INCLUDE_DIRS ${DBoW2_INCLUDE_DIRS}") message("opencv ${OpenCV_VERSION}") # dbow3 # dbow3 is a simple lib so I assume you installed it in default directory set( DBoW3_LIBS "/usr/local/lib/libDBoW3.a") add_executable(${PROJECT_NAME} src/loop_closure.cpp src/run_main.cpp ${DBoW2_SRCS}/BowVector.cpp ${DBoW2_SRCS}/FBrief.cpp ${DBoW2_SRCS}/FeatureVector.cpp ${DBoW2_SRCS}/FORB.cpp ${DBoW2_SRCS}/FSurf64.cpp ${DBoW2_SRCS}/QueryResults.cpp ${DBoW2_SRCS}/ScoringObject.cpp ) message(${DBoW2_SRCS}/BowVector.cpp) target_link_libraries(${PROJECT_NAME} ${OpenCV_LIBS} ${DLib_LIBS} ${DBoW3_LIBS} )
